What does it take to buy and scale a company in a foreign country, with your spouse, right before a global pandemic?
00:00 — Cold open: No backup plan, just make it work
01:07 — Welcome to CEOs Unscripted: Jane's intro & what the show is about
02:46 — Meet Corbin Butcher: From Chicago to the Czech Republic
04:18 — Corbin's background: Army officer, Iraq tours, Kellogg MBA
06:06 — Why investment banking wasn't the fit — and what was
07:07 — The search fund model: Buying a business with your spouse
08:18 — The challenge of being a European company trying to break into the US market
10:51 — How to vet a strategic partner (and why face-to-face is non-negotiable)
13:44 — The qualities that make or break a partnership under pressure
15:08 — American work ethic vs. European work culture: The real clash
17:08 — How Corbin built a high-performance culture within European labor laws
20:31 — The pros and cons of being an American CEO leading a European company
21:50 — Running a business with your spouse: The investor who called it "marital risk"
24:38 — How Corbin and Evona divide roles and break ties
25:36 — First-time CEO with no safety net: How do you learn on the fly?
28:59 — The shock of COVID hitting an 85% leveraged company in year two
31:40 — Biere 1.0 vs. 2.0 vs. 3.0: The lifecycle framework every CEO needs to understand
33:13 — Sales in 1.0: A shoebox of business cards as a "CRM"
36:53 — Operations in 1.0: When everything depends on one person
38:18 — Why promoting your best operator to supervisor is often a mistake
41:30 — What changed in 2.0: Systems, structure, and elevating internal talent
43:05 — The power of vision: Can every employee in your company articulate where you're going?
46:01 — How Corbin had to change as a leader from 1.0 to 2.0
49:46 — How strategic planning evolves at each stage of company growth
52:54 — Honest reflection: Some parts of Bira are still in 1.0 — and that's okay
54:01 — Rapid fire: Who's the smartest person in your phone?
55:36 — Best book of the last 12 months: The Wright Brothers by David McCullough
57:09 — What Corbin does when he feels stuck
58:27 — Closing thoughts and where to find more
Hosted by Jane Gentry, CEO advisor, Harvard Business School Entrepreneurial MBA mentor, and consultant to mid-market leaders for over 20 years, CEOs Unscripted is a bi-weekly podcast featuring unfiltered conversations with founders and executives who've been where you are.
